The study of electromagnetic nucleon production experiments of the
type A
and A
is an active field. One of its major
goals is the study of the limitations of the mean-field picture for
nuclei. Two-nucleon knockout experiments offer the opportunity to
study central and tensor correlations in nuclei. The extraction of
physical information from the data is not a straightforward exercise
and involves theoretical modeling. Results of
,
and semi-exclusive
calculations will be
presented. The role of two-nucleon photoabsorption mechanisms for the
extraction of spectroscopic factors from exclusive A
processes will be discussed.
